2017-12-08crypto: actually stash session keys when decrypt=trueDaniel Kahn Gillmor
If you're going to store the cleartext index of an encrypted message, in most situations you might just as well store the session key. Doing this storage has efficiency and recoverability advantages. Combined with a schedule of regular OpenPGP subkey rotation and destruction, this can also offer security benefits, like "deletable e-mail", which is the store-and-forward analog to "forward secrecy". But wait, i hear you saying, i have a special need to store cleartext indexes but it's really bad for me to store session keys! Maybe (let's imagine) i get lots of e-mails with incriminating photos attached, and i want to be able to search for them by the text in the e-mail, but i don't want someone with access to the index to be actually able to see the photos themselves. Fret not, the next patch in this series will support your wacky uncommon use case.

2017-12-04crypto: use stashed session-key properties for decryption, if availableDaniel Kahn Gillmor
When doing any decryption, if the notmuch database knows of any session keys associated with the message in question, try them before defaulting to using default symmetric crypto. This changeset does the primary work in _notmuch_crypto_decrypt, which grows some new parameters to handle it. The primary advantage this patch offers is a significant speedup when rendering large encrypted threads ("notmuch show") if session keys happen to be cached. Additionally, it permits message composition without access to asymmetric secret keys ("notmuch reply"); and it permits recovering a cleartext index when reindexing after a "notmuch restore" for those messages that already have a session key stored. Note that we may try multiple decryptions here (e.g. if there are multiple session keys in the database), but we will ignore and throw away all the GMime errors except for those that come from last decryption attempt. Since we don't necessarily know at the time of the decryption that this *is* the last decryption attempt, we'll ask for the errors each time anyway. This does nothing if no session keys are stashed in the database, which is fine. Actually stashing session keys in the database will come as a subsequent patch.

2017-10-21crypto: index encrypted parts when indexopts try_decrypt is set.Daniel Kahn Gillmor
If we see index options that ask us to decrypt when indexing a message, and we encounter an encrypted part, we'll try to descend into it. If we can decrypt, we add the property index.decryption=success. If we can't decrypt (or recognize the encrypted type of mail), we add the property index.decryption=failure. Note that a single message may have both values of the "index.decryption" property: "success" and "failure". For example, consider a message that includes multiple layers of encryption. If we manage to decrypt the outer layer ("index.decryption=success"), but fail on the inner layer ("index.decryption=failure"). Because of the property name, this will be automatically cleared (and possibly re-set) during re-indexing. This means it will subsequently correspond to the actual semantics of the stored index.

2015-01-24Add indexing for the mimetype termTodd
This adds the indexing support for the "mimetype:" term and removes the broken test flag. The indexing is probablistic in Xapian terms, which gives a better experience to end users. Standard content-types of the form "foo/bar" are automatically interpreted as phrases in Xapian due to the embedded slash. Assume, separate messages with application/pdf and application/x-pdf are indexed, then: - mimetype:application/x-pdf will find only the application/x-pdf - mimetype:application/pdf will find only the application/pdf - mimetype:pdf will find both of the messages
2014-06-18lib: Index name and address of from/to headers as a phraseAustin Clements
Previously, we indexed the name and address parts of from/to headers with two calls to _notmuch_message_gen_terms. In general, this indicates that these parts are separate phrases. However, because of an implementation quirk, the two calls to _notmuch_message_gen_terms generated adjacent term positions for the prefixed terms, which happens to be the right thing to do in this case, but the wrong thing to do for all other calls. Furthermore, _notmuch_message_gen_terms produced potentially overlapping term positions for the un-prefixed copies of the terms, which is simply wrong. This change indexes both the name and address in a single call to _notmuch_message_gen_terms, indicating that they should be part of a single phrase. This masks the problem with the un-prefixed terms (fixing the two known-broken tests) and puts us in a position to fix the unintentionally phrases generated by other calls to _notmuch_message_gen_terms.
2014-04-05lib: replace the header parser with gmimeJani Nikula
The notmuch library includes a full blown message header parser. Yet the same message headers are parsed by gmime during indexing. Switch to gmime parsing completely. These are the main changes: * Gmime stops header parsing at the first invalid header, and presumes the message body starts from there. The current parser is quite liberal in accepting broken headers. The change means we will be much pickier about accepting invalid messages. * The current parser converts tabs used in header folding to spaces. Gmime preserve the tabs. Due to a broken python library used in mailman, there are plenty of mailing lists that produce headers with tabs in header folding, and we'll see plenty of tabs. (This change has been mitigated in preparatory patches.) * For pure header parsing, the current parser is likely faster than gmime, which parses the whole message rather than just the headers. Since we parse the message and its headers using gmime for indexing anyway, this avoids and extra header parsing round when adding new messages. In case of duplicate messages, we'll end up parsing the full message although just headers would be sufficient. All in all this should still speed up 'notmuch new'. * Calls to notmuch_message_get_header() may be slightly slower than previously for headers that are not indexed in the database, due to parsing of the whole message. Within the notmuch code base, notmuch reply is the only such user.

2012-11-26lib: Reject multi-message mboxes and deprecate single-message mboxAustin Clements
Previously, we would treat multi-message mboxes as one giant email, which, besides the obvious incorrect indexing, often led to out-of-memory errors for archival mboxes. Now we explicitly reject multi-message mboxes. For historical reasons, we retain support for single-message mboxes, but official deprecate this behavior.

2011-12-29Ignore encrypted parts when indexing.Jameson Graef Rollins
It appears to be an oversight that encrypted parts were indexed previously. The terms generated from encrypted parts are meaningless and do nothing but add bloat to the database. It is not worth indexing the encrypted content, just as it's not worth indexing the signatures in signed parts.
2011-05-27tag signed/encrypted during notmuch newJameson Graef Rollins
This patch adds the tag "signed" to messages with any multipart/signed parts, and the tag "encrypted" to messages with any multipart/encrypted parts. This only occurs when messages are indexed during notmuch new, so a database rebuild is required to have old messages tagged.

2010-02-04notmuch new: Don't index uuencoded data.Carl Worth
With modern MIME attachments, we're already avoiding indexing the attachments. But for old-school uuencoded data in the mail, we have been directly indexing the encoded data as terms, (which is not useful at all---nobody will ever ytry to search based on the seemingly random uuencoded data). Additionally, indexing a modestly large uuencoded file seems to make Xapian go insane, (consuming *lots* of memory). We fix both problems by detecting uuencoded content and not performing any indexing of it.

2010-01-06database: Store mail filename as a new 'direntry' term, not as 'data'.Carl Worth
Instead of storing the complete message filename in the data portion of a mail document we now store a 'direntry' term that contains the document ID of a directory document and also the basename of the message filename within that directory. This will allow us to easily store multple filenames for a single message, and will also allow us to find mail documents for files that previously existed in a directory but that have since been deleted.
